Emotional Content

May 4th, 2008 · 1 Comment

Over at PvP Scott Kurtz has been doing something that very few storytellers can do well - engender real emotion. I’ve been reading his daily strip, and buying the collections from Image, for years now, and while it’s mostly quick jokes he’s very good at making you feel for the characters. Right now he’s doing the Wedding of Brent & Jade, and it’s an absolute masterwork. He hasn’t really done a joke in the strip for about a week, instead using the 10 years of history he’s built up for these characters to carry the story. I thought that strip from Saturday, with Jade being escorted down the aisle by Cole, a single tear running down his cheek, couldn’t be topped. Until I saw today’s strip, in which for the first time ever Brent takes his sunglasses off as he and Jade exchange vows. Lesser cartoonists would have felt the need to put a joke in - make him cross-eyed or something like that - but Kurtz does the right thing and instead uses it for a real emotional punch. The beauty of serial storytelling is in moments like this. Years of character development that can pay off with a simple line under the eyes. Bravo, Scott.

NYCC Day 2 - Ventures, DC, Sci-Fi, Image and the Legion

April 20th, 2008 · No Comments

Day 2 began much the same as day 1, just a bit earlier. When I showed up just before noon the floor was absolutely packed. And every time I ventured up to the show floor proper it got more and more crowded (apparently the fire marshal once again stopped new entries to the Javitz center for a while in the middle of the afternoon). The energy level on the floor was great. It’s nominally a comic-con, but pretty much every discipline of the nerdly arts was represented in full force. In particular today there were a lot of cosplayers and Gothic Lolitas all over the place. But most of all the place was just mobbed. The line for the theater where they were holding most of the TV and movie panels wrapped across the hall several times over. The lines in Hall 1E for the simultaneous panels covering the Venture Bros, Zombie Survival and Gothic Lolitas were so massive they closed off the hallway.

A Mortal Kombat vs. DC Fighting Game?!?

April 18th, 2008 · No Comments

Sometimes you hear a bit of news that just makes you scratch your head and go “Huh?” This is one of those times. Apparently, Midway is going to be making a Mortal Kombat vs. DC fighting game. This rumor had been floating around for a little while now (I think I first heard it in December), but it was chalked up as slash-fic run rampant. But while Midway was clearly building up to an announcement of some sort, I don’t think anyone really expected something that…different. Now, mortal kombat online (which is getting absolutely hammered at the moment) produces something approaching tangible proof, a teaser image supposedly leaked early from Midway.

Mortal Kombat vs. DC Teaser

I’m not quite sure how I feel about this one. I’m a big Mortal Kombat fan (hell, I’m a fighting game fan, period) so a new game, especially one built on the Unreal 3 engine, is right up my alley. But inserting DC characters into it? I just don’t know. According to Maxconsole a Midway source has said that the game will have “no fatalities and little-to-no blood”. That’s in line with DC’s policies on the characters, but an MK game without fatalaties? Combine that with the less than stellar track record of DC-based videogames (there hasn’t been a really good one since the NES, and at least 3 DC games are considered some of the worst games of all time) and I get a little nervous about this one. I’ll try to get some more news on this one at the New York Comic Con today.
